“The hearing is scheduled for August 28 at 9:15 a.m.,” court spokeswoman Elena Mesenko told Interfax.

She noted that the prosecutor's office filed one lawsuit against two parents at once.

Earlier, the presidential ombudsman for children, Anna Kuznetsova, said she intended to appeal to the Prosecutor General’s Office with a request to withdraw the claim for the deprivation of parental rights of spouses who came to an uncoordinated rally on July 27 with a one-year-old son.

At the same time, the children's ombudsman noted that “preventive and preventive measures are needed so that such cases do not recur.”
